Chongjian Zhou is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Civil and Structural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Chongjian Zhou has authored 56 papers receiving a total of 2.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 52 papers in Materials Chemistry, 36 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 14 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ering. Recurrent topics in Chongjian Zhou’s work include Advanced Thermoelectric Materials and Devices (46 papers), Chalcogenide Semiconductor Thin Films (27 papers) and Thermal properties of materials (14 papers). Chongjian Zhou is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Thermoelectric Materials and Devices (46 papers), Chalcogenide Semiconductor Thin Films (27 papers) and Thermal properties of materials (14 papers). Chongjian Zhou collaborates with scholars based in China, Germany and South Korea. Chongjian Zhou's co-authors include In Jae Chung, Yuan Yu, Sung‐Pyo Cho, Yong Kyu Lee, Matthias Wuttig, Guanjun Qiao, Guiwu Liu, Oana Cojocaru‐Mirédin, Bangzhi Ge and Ke Wang and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Advanced Materials and Nature Materials.
